On Wednesday, September 10, 2025, Charlie Kirk, a well-known conservative activist and executive director of Turning Point USA (TPUSA), was shot while speaking at a TPUSA chapter event at Utah Valley University. The incident took place in the university courtyard during a stop on Kirk’s ‘The American Comeback Tour.’ Social media footage captured the moment Kirk was struck while seated under a tent, with students fleeing the scene as gunshots rang out.

A TPUSA press team spokesperson confirmed to Fox News that Kirk was shot, though details about his condition had not been disclosed at the time of writing.

Charlie Kirk has died after being shot at an event on Wednesday afternoon at Utah Valley University.

A Utah Valley University police spokesperson also verified that gunfire occurred on campus. A suspect is in custody, Utah Valley University told students in an alert. The shooting is under investigation.
